In-Home Senior Care
Many people find that staying at home with some help can be more advantageous than moving into an assisted living facility or nursing home. Seniors with physical or cognitive issues can often maintain independence in their homes when professional caregivers come into their home to offer the necessary support.
Full-Time Care
Full-time care involves a live-in caregiver staying in the senior’s home, usually providing round-the-clock ass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) like bathing, dressing and eating.
